As many of you know, I have the privilege of leading an incredible peer workforce with Stride’s The Way Back Support Service, supporting people after a suicide attempt. Every day I see the strength, courage and resilience of people rebuilding their lives after experiencing one of their darkest moments.

What many people don’t realise is that the risk of another suicide attempt is highest within the first three months following an attempt. That is why suicide aftercare is so important. During this critical time, having someone who listens without judgement, walks alongside you, helps reconnect you with your community and reminds you that hope is possible can make an enormous difference.

While this fundraiser supports mental health services across the continuum, it’s especially meaningful to me because I see firsthand the impact that timely, compassionate aftercare has on people’s recovery.
